Hi Ben,
I suspect that "Lifore" is in fact Lison an hamlet in the municipality of Portogruaro which has been an autonomous parish since the 16th century. The long s is often confused with an "f".
If the act you're searching is post-1871 you can probably find it here:
https://www.familysearch.org/search/ima ... %3D2043809
For earlier generations there are the church records.
